Sir Robin leads 1-0 as we go into the second tilt. Sir Tanty is not so steady in the saddle as he was. The crowd is tucking into its vole's ears inna bun (sponsored by Griselda's Bakery of Harbottle). The knights are ready.
 |
Kick Phase |
Both knights set off at a steady gallop again.
 |
Charge Phase |
As they close on each other Sir Tanty once more prepares better than Sir Robin and lines up a sweep attack.
 |
Clash Phase |
In his signature move, Sir Robin throws everything he has into the final clash, risking everything for the sake of a dramatic finish, while Sir Tanty retains a little in reserve for the next tilt. Sir Robin lands a solid blow on Sir Tanty's chest. He breaks his lance and Sir Tanty reels backwards in the saddle (Battered, -2P). Almost in slow motion, Sir Tanty desperately tries to cling to the saddle but the strength of Sir Robin's blow was too great. He topples sideways and lands awkwardly on his shoulder. The crowd roars its approval at seeing a noble brought low into the mud. Chants of "Sir Robin" roar about the lists. Sir Robin has won and is given the golden laurel wreath of the Champion of Talomir.
Sir Robin gains 15 Fame and 1500 Florins for defeating Sir Tanty.
For winning the tournament he gains 15 fame and 1500 Florins.
Sir Tanty gains 7 Fame and 750 Florins for coming second.
Sir Tenley gains 3 Fame and 375 Florins for coming third.
